What is the name of the star used for JWST's first light alignment?

The story behind the answer

The star used for JWST’s first-light alignment was HD 84406. This relatively faint, seventh-magnitude star lies in the constellation Ursa Major, about 260 light-years from Earth.

After launch, Webb had to align its 18 hexagonal primary-mirror segments so they would function as one precise telescope. Engineers selected HD 84406 because it was bright enough for the Near Infrared Camera, or NIRCam, but isolated enough to identify clearly. Its position also kept it available throughout the early commissioning period.

In February 2022, NIRCam detected the star as 18 separate, blurry points—one image from each misaligned mirror segment. Teams matched those images to the corresponding segments, corrected their positions and focus, and gradually stacked the images into one. This painstaking process brought the mirror into alignment to an accuracy of roughly 50 nanometers.

HD 84406 was not JWST’s first major science target or first released deep-space image. It was a calibration and alignment target. Sirius, Polaris and Betelgeuse are prominent stars, but they were not the star chosen for this initial mirror-alignment procedure.
